CORPUS CHRISTI, Texas – Around 20 local elementary and middle school students in the National Youth Sports Program (NYSP) at Texas A&M University-Corpus Christi will learn how to kayak Monday, June 23, from 10 a.m. to 12:30 p.m. at Little Bay in Rockport.
The instruction will be led by Dr. Jim Needham, dean of community outreach, and Joe Miller, director of education and youth issues, at Texas A&M-Corpus Christi.
During the field trip, students also will learn about water safety, how to paddle and plants and animals in the area. Little Bay is near the Texas Maritime Museum. |
